Indian nationality Nand Mulchandani becomes first-ever CIA's Chief Technology Officer

Mulchandani, who has over 25 years of experience working in Silicon Valley and most recently the Department of Defense, offers “substantial private sector, startup, and government” expertise to the agency, according to the CIA.

The United States’ first defense agency, the Central Intelligence Agency (CIA), announced the hiring of Nand Mulchandani as its first-ever Chief Technology Officer (CTO) on Monday. William J. Burns, the director of the CIA, announced the appointment and stated that Mulchandani has over 25 years of experience working in Silicon Valley and, most recently, the Department of Defense. Mulchandani adds “substantial private sector, startup, and government” expertise to the agency.

According to Burns, Mulchandani will make sure the organization is using cutting-edge advances for the CIA’s missions. As CTO, he continued, “scanning the horizon for tomorrow’s innovations to further the CIA’s mission” will be on his agenda.

I’ve made it a priority to concentrate on technology since my confirmation, and the new CTO role is crucial to that endeavor. Director Burns expressed his happiness at Nand’s joining the team and how he will contribute his wealth of knowledge to this important new position.

Mulchandani was the US Department of Defense’s CTO and acting director of the Joint Artificial Intelligence Center prior to joining the intelligence organization. Mulchandani is a serial entrepreneur who co-founded and served as CEO of several profitable businesses, including ScaleXtreme (bought by Citrix), OpenDNS (purchased by Cisco), Determina (acquired by VMware), and Oblix (acquired by Oracle). Mulchandani stated he “could not refuse” the job offer in his announcement post on LinkedIn.

“It is an honor for me to join the CIA in this capacity, and I look forward to working with the amazing team of technologists and subject matter experts within the agency who already provide top-notch intelligence and capabilities to help develop a comprehensive technology strategy that yields exciting capabilities in close collaboration with partners and industry,” Mulchandani stated. He adores tiny, nimble teams that are driven to upend large markets. Mulchandani’s LinkedIn page states that he has a good history in enterprise infrastructure products, marketing, and sales.

Mulchandani graduated from South Delhi’s Bluebells School in 1987, according to his LinkedIn profile. He continued on to Cornell University in the US to obtain a Bachelor of Science in Mathematics and Computer Science. then went to Stanford to get a Master of Science in Management, and afterwards to Harvard to get a Master of Public Administration.
